What is the first phase of embryonic development

What is the cell division through the first phase of the embryonic development called? Also explain that how is this stage characterized?

The cell division in the initial stage of the embryonic progress is called cleavage, or segmentation. In this phase many mitoses take place from the zygote forming the new embryo.
